Original Description
Ta-tay-hac-don by Henri Edmond Cross is a radiant example of Neo-Impressionist mastery, shimmering with the luminous brilliance of Pointillism. Painted in 1906, the work captures the idyllic Mediterranean landscape through thousands of meticulously placed dots of pure pigment, blending optically to create an ethereal glow. Cross, a key figure in the Divisionist movement alongside Seurat and Signac, imbues the scene with a dreamlike harmony—azure skies dance over golden fields, while delicate brushstrokes evoke the shimmering heat of southern France. Historically, this piece reflects the transition from structured Divisionism to the more expressive Fauvism, making it a pivotal work in early modernist experimentation. Its chromatic intensity and rhythmic composition embody the artistic pursuit of "harmony in diversity," cementing Cross's legacy as a bridge between 19th-century scientific precision and 20th-century emotional abstraction.
